Abandoned uranium mines pose health risk to New Mexicans

By | 05.07.09 | 12:29 am

New Mexico legislators are in Washington D.C. this week to press the federal government to help clean up hundreds of abandoned uranium mines that dot the state’s landscape. The trip comes on the heels of an appropriation of $150,000 included in this year’s state budget to help complete the painstaking work of assessing the extent of the problem: Of 259 mines that reported uranium production to the state, 137 have no record of clean up.
